<p>Why are lifestyle videos so popular, and what are they doing to us? In this episode, I explore how many modern lifestyle videos prioritize atmosphere over personality. Beautiful cafés, minimalist rooms, quiet routines, and carefully edited moments create a calming experience, but they may also encourage creators to suppress strong opinions, imperfections, and individuality. I argue that this gradual “hollowing out” of personality reflects modern loneliness and the fear of conflict. As AI becomes better at producing polished, harmless content, authentic human qualities—contradictions, flaws, passion, and emotional depth—may become more valuable than ever before.</p>
